Introduction Event management has gained application in so many sectors of the Canadian economy. The sports industry is one such area that requires special attention. This is because it involves the outdoors, it has the capacity to draw large crowds and the magnitude of sponsors involved is usually high. However, for purposes of this paper, special emphasis will be given to an ice event sponsored by The Red Bull Company known as Red Bull crashed Ice. This event will be based in Quebec City and most of the recommendations given will be based on the location. (Red Bull Crashed Ice, 2008) Also, the essay will be a discussion of the vendors needed to make such an event successful. Examples of vendors that will be discussed include; food vendors, beverage vendors, advertising vendors, Music and entertainment vendors, ancillary vendors and security vendors. Food vendors A sports event without food is a failed one. Reports indicate that many Canadians including the ones at Quebec City are looking for snack based foods. Some of the most common foods to be found in such events include peanuts, soft drinks, hotdogs, and ice cream. Consequently, the Red Bull Crashed Ice event will be more of a success if it contained some of the latter mentioned items. Dry foods such as peanuts and other snack may be sold by many vendors. However, food requiring some sort of heating such as hotdogs and sausages will need to be sold by vendors with stands. The company either has the choice of having stalls where the vendors could be located or alternatively, they could offer these items in carts. The latter approach would be more feasible than the former one because of the fact that the event will only last for one day. Additionally, most food vendors are usually contract based; consequently, most of them may already have their own facilities that would assist them in the process of selling their merchandise. In order to determine how much reception the sports fun will give to a food type, it is essential for one to consider the nature of the sport. In sports where there is less action, then people are likely to get out of their seats and buy items. The Red Bull Ice event will be packed with action as it is naturally a fast sport. (Red Bull Crashed Ice, 2008)Additionally, the weather or the condition of the venue plays a large role. It has been noted that when it is extremely cold, people tend to stay in their seats and move around less, however, when it is warm, then they are likely to look for food stands. In order to ensure that food vendors conduct their business people, it will be essential for food vendors to move around with the commodities because the nature of event is likely to trigger minimal participation from people. In order to boost the success of this event, it will be important for the food vendors to offer a wide variety of foods. For instance, hamburgers, pizzas and some deep fried chicken may be an alternative. It should be noted that most people tend to prefer certain dry foods in sports events because it gives them the flexibility to stand up and cheer their teams without worrying about dropping their food. This means, that the food on offer needs to be easy to handle. There are various ways in which the company can access such food vendors. First of all, it could find out some of the vendors that have taken part in previous events in Quebec thus hiring them. The best way of doing this is by consulting with previous sponsors of the game. Alternatively, the company could search through numerous Food vending sites across the Internet which contain lists of people who have worked in the sporting event before. These vendors normally place their resumes on those websites and the company can then prove whether the claims made in those advertisements are true by calling some of their previous clients. Additionally, some vendors have created websites of where to find them and where they are based Quebec City has a wide range to choose from. One such company is known as Kijiji Edmonton. This company was created with the purpose of serving food during events. The company normally charges no hiring fees and will make money off the sales that they manage to make during one's event. This is because drinks are handy to carry around and are refreshing. Beverage vendors may either sell soft drinks or alcoholic ones. However, because the event will be sponsored by Red Bull (Red Bull Crashed Ice, 2008); a mildly alcoholic beverage, then the company should not allow other alcoholic drinks to compete with them directly - only soft drinks should be allowed in the event. Vendors serving the Red Bull drinks will need to know the dangers of selling alcohol to minors. Additionally, buyers ought to be provided with free water so as to curb cases of drunkenness. Besides this, the vendors will also be required to limit the number of servings which they offer to certain individuals so as to bring order in the event. It should also be noted that continuous alcohol intake may actually cause brawls and other forms of disorganization within the company. This can make the event highly unsuccessful. For instance, it could cause property damage, vandalism just to name a few. Aside from Red Bull as an alcoholic drink, there will also be a number of soft drinks. It would be advisable to select vendors from different categories or companies. This is in order to make up for the differing tastes in soft drinks within specific events. It should also be noted that some groups may not necessarily enjoy certain drinks but this may actually be countered when there are a wide range of them. Entertainment vendors In order to ascertain that the Red Bull event becomes a success, a lot of resources will have to be dedicated to the entertainment aspect. The first thing that comes to mind when considering a sports event is the music. The company will have to hire an experienced Sports event DJ. In order to ensure that he is able to effectively handle this challenge, it will be important to make certain that the DJ works for a reputable company. Since Quebec City has so many entertainment companies, issues such as costs and scheduling issues have to be put in mind. The DJs chosen for the event will also need to get people hyped up. In order to do this, they must play music that suits the demographics in the event. Since the event is expected to attract a large pool of youth and teenagers (Red Bull Crashed Ice, 2008), then the DJ must put this into consideration. Besides the latter issues, care must be taken to ensure that the vendors hired for the event are highly skilled in coordinating music types. For instance at the start of the event, it may be important to play music that will get the crowd absorbed into the event. Somewhere in the middle when people have begun catching up then this will have to be hyped up. At the end of the event, there may be a need to play music at a lower tempo. These are all intricacies that can be handled by someone who has had prior experience in management of large sporting events. The types of equipments used in entertainment will also be imperative in predicting the outcome of the event. This means that the nature of the music equipment chosen for the event needs to be in top condition. This can only be done by selecting vendors with the right expertise in this field. Additionally, a lot of attention should be given to the overall nature of the sporting event. Security vendors Source: http://www.sportseventsecurity.com/ A number of terrorist attacks have been held in public places and one of the freshest events that occurred was the September eleven attacks. After this occurrence, the US alongside its neighbors woke up to the harsh reality of the looming terror threat to its country. Consequently, whenever one is planning to hold a public event such as the Red Bull crashed ice one, then there ought to be adequate security preparation. Security vendors will be important in the establishment of order in the event and also in providing a number of services. Since so many tasks will be carried out by this group, then it is imperative for one to look for ways in which they can enhance this experience by looking for certain features in security vendors. First of all the vendor of choice should be one who has experience in crowd management. In the event that a brawl occurs or that there is some form of chaos in the crowd, then there should be adequate control of it through the security personnel. Consequently, vendors must be physically and emotionally prepared to handle such crowds. Additionally, the ideal security vendor is one who can deal with isolated incidences of violence from the fans. For instance, in a basketball tournament, a fan was angered by the fact that his team was losing, he woke up and threw a can of beer at a player. The security personnel did not respond fast enough and this eventually drew other members of the crowd thus causing a lot of commotion. The security vendors to be chosen for this event should be those ones who have had prior experience in dealing with such incidences especially sports related ones. One should also put in mind the fact that security personnel need to be well versed with other more dangerous security issues. For instance, they need to be ready for incidences that may occur as a result of the use of explosives or small weapons or weapons of mass destruction. These kinds of threats have been identified by many security companies and most of them have asserted that an event cannot be said to fully secure, when dangerous ammunition has not been adequately handled. Security vendors chosen for this issue will have to demonstrate that they have adequate expertise in the field. They need to show that they have acquired experience there and that there are adequate levels of protection in those areas. (Red Bull Crashed Ice, 2008) Lastly, the security vendor chosen for the event needs to undergo training in the venue of the event. This is because each event has its own security threats. By undergoing training there, the company will be in a position to assess the kind of security threat in the event and thus look for ways of preventing it. In fact, security experts assert that the most successful security endeavors are those ones that start from prevention rather than mitigation of the event. In order to ascertain that the company chosen has actually gone through this, then there will be a need to look at certificates for workshop attendance in security, testimonials from other companies that have hired them and have been satisfied with their services. Also, evidence of training will also have to be indicated through training certificates. It should also be noted that for there is a need for the efficient coordination of the following aspects -Equipment -People -Products These are all issues that need to be protected by security personnel so as to ensure that they are present when they are required. Additionally, care needs to be taken to ensure that there are adequate levels of finance in all these areas. (Red Bull Crashed Ice, 2008) The security team also needs to demonstrate that they are adequately prepared to tackle a fire incident. In case of anything, the security team needs to be in a position where they can handle some of the major hurdles that emanate from a fire. Some of them include staying calm and safely evacuating members of the crowd out of the building. Ancillary service vendors For the Red Bull event to be a success there is a need for efficient coordination of all the small aspects that in essence could not make the event worthwhile. Some of the activities that need to be considered here include checking for tickets, making audience arrangements, showing people where to seat and the like. All these activities fall within the ancillary service section. The major qualities that need to be examined by event coordinators in choosing these vendors is their flexibility. Because some of these tasks are relatively simple, then they can be handled by one particular company. The company needs to demonstrate that they can check for tickets, well, that they have good ushering skills (by showing people where to seat) and also they need to illustrate that they are capable of handling certain other responsibilities that may arise individually among the fans. It is essential for the ancillary vendor chosen for this event to be fairly priced. Since there are numerous vendors who are willing to provide such services, then the service organizers have a wide range of options to choose from. This also means that they have the right to get value for their money by employing only those groups that demonstrate their full capabilities in handling this matter. Electronic vendors The latter event will also be in need of electronic service vendors because the expected crowd will need to hear everything that is going on. Consequently, providers will need amplifiers that are large enough and those ones that have the right pitch and tone. Additionally, a public address system will need to be instated. There are a number of vendors who own these kinds of equipments and they normally rent them out to those in need of them. Consequently, the event can only be labeled a success if communication is done clearly and this will be by selecting vendors who has good equipment. In order to ascertain that this is done correctly, then the service vendor will have to be tested on the quality of his sound systems. Conclusion Carrying out an event such as the Red Bull crashed Ice competition will involve numerous vendors. (Red Bull Crashed Ice, 2008)Some of them may need to demonstrate high levels of experience and these include security and entertainment vendors. Others may need to offer low hiring prices such as ancillary service providers and food and beverage vendors. Some of the places where these vendors can be accessed are through their company websites and also through previous vent holders who have positive experiences with them.
